Tangible Benefits

Benefit

Assumptions

Reduced need for large disk space. 

At present the SATSTAGE package is generating circa 1gb of audit tables each time it runs, in order to accomodate the volume of data generated a 500gb space with 1tb backup space has been allocated to the system.  Both of these spaces could be substaintially reduced if the audit tables size is respectively reduced. 

Benefit is based on freeing up 0.5 tb of Diskspace at annual cost of £1,270 per tb.

Reduction in failures of Data Transfer and recovery process (Cost Avoidance)During the start of term 2013/14 the SPDA data transfers failed on multiple occasions.  Every time the transfer fails it requires a member of production staff to restart the transfer, assess the amount of data lost in the failed transfer and re-submit the data lost.  Over the first five weeks of terms roughly 10 days was expended restarting and recoving the data transfer mechanism.  Please note that the transfer mechanism was substaintially reduced in frequency during this time and futher into term it was only run once a week as a coping measure during the recovery process.

 

 

Intangible Benefits

Benefit

Assumptions

Performance improvement to the Live system.

Scientia have confirmed that the amount of data included in the SDB directly impacts performance and reliability of the service.  Eliminating circa 20,000 excess student records and 10,000 excess staff records for the system will have a positive impact on performance.

Timetabling for 2014/15

As the Syllabus Plus Database (SDB) only covers a single academic year, the ideal position is to fix the interfaces before they are required as part of annual roll forward.  By resolving the issues with too much data being presented this will ensure that the 2014/15 database has the best chance of acceptable performance.
